the majority of things that you might want to do to your machine can be handled by coding in Lua, and for this the Mach4CoreAPI.chm is perfect.
You may notice that the API gives both Lua and C/C++ syntax. Further you may notice that there are specific and critical motion commands that do not have
Lua syntax, these are intended for C/C++ use only, ie within a plugin, and as Steve pointed out then you need to enter into an NDA with NFS.
May I suggest you experiment with Lua to start with, I think you'll be very pleasantly surprised about the functionality it provides WITHOUT the need to write a plugin.
